The Role of a Physical Therapist in Your Recovery
A physical therapist is a trained movement expert who evaluates injuries, restores physical function, and helps patients reduce pain and prevent reinjury through targeted treatment.
At our physical therapy clinic serving High Ridge, MO, your therapist may:
- Conduct a comprehensive movement evaluation
- Pinpoint the root cause of your pain or dysfunction
- Design a personalized treatment plan, often working alongside your physician
- Provide hands-on manual therapy when appropriate
- Prescribe corrective exercises to improve strength and mobility
- Track your progress and update your plan when necessary
Our approach focuses on identifying the underlying causes of pain rather than simply masking symptoms. These problems are frequently linked to muscle imbalances, restricted joints, or inefficient movement patterns. Addressing these underlying problems helps lower the likelihood of reinjury.

High Ridge, MO Physical Therapy Clinic FAQs
Do I need a doctor’s referral to start physical therapy?
Both Missouri and Illinois offer direct access physical therapy, which means you can be evaluated by and begin treatment with a licensed physical therapist without needing a physician referral or prescription.
How long does physical therapy take?
The timeline for therapy varies depending on the condition being treated and the patient’s goals. While some individuals recover quickly, more complex injuries or post-surgical recovery may require several months of rehabilitation. Your therapist will outline a recommended timeline during your evaluation.
Does insurance cover physical therapy?
Many health insurance policies include coverage for medically necessary physical therapy. Our clinic works with many insurance providers and our staff can help you review your coverage and communicate with your insurer before treatment begins.
Patients without insurance can work with our team to explore affordable self-pay options. As members of the High Ridge, MO community ourselves, we understand the importance of accessible healthcare and work to provide practical solutions for patients.
What happens during my first physical therapy appointment?
Your initial visit typically includes a full evaluation, movement assessment, and discussion of your goals before beginning your personalized treatment plan.
How should I dress for physical therapy?
Wear comfortable clothing that allows you to move freely. Clothing similar to what you might wear for exercise generally works well.
